When is the best time to plan a golf trip to Gros Islet?

You'll find the absolute best conditions for golf between December and May, during St. Lucia's dry season. The weather is consistently sunny and the refreshing trade winds keep you comfortable on the course, making for perfect playing days.

What kind of golf experience can I expect at the Gros Islet course?

The St. Lucia Golf Club offers a truly engaging round with significant elevation changes and panoramic views of both the Caribbean Sea and the Atlantic. It's a well-maintained par-71 that demands thoughtful shot placement, especially on its challenging back nine.

Is the Gros Islet golf course suitable for all skill levels, or is it very challenging?

While the course certainly presents a good test for experienced players, it's surprisingly welcoming for higher handicappers too. The fairways are generally generous, and the staff are fantastic, making it an enjoyable experience regardless of your skill level.

What should I budget for a round of golf in Gros Islet, including club rentals?

Expect to pay around $150-$200 USD for a round, which typically includes a cart. If you're renting clubs, factor in an additional $50-$70; the quality of their rental sets is usually quite good, so you won't feel disadvantaged.

Beyond the golf course, what are the must-do activities near Gros Islet?

You absolutely have to experience the Gros Islet Friday Night Street Party- it's a vibrant local tradition with great food and music. We also recommend exploring Pigeon Island National Park for its historical ruins and breathtaking views, or simply relaxing on Reduit Beach.
